Frequently Asked Questions about East Woodstock

What type of rentals are currently available in East Woodstock?

There are currently 52 Apartments for Rent in East Woodstock, CT with pricing that ranges from $1,065 to $7,780. There are also 37 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in East Woodstock ranging from $1,250 to $5,000.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in East Woodstock?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in East Woodstock ranges from $1,250 to $5,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,464.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in East Woodstock?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in East Woodstock range from $1,145 to $4,050,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,250 to $5,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,200 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,200.
